ORIGINAL: MHShockey30

The nitrous is definetly the best bang for the buck. Like fazm said, it will cost you about $1000 for the nitrous, racers kit, and a dyno tune, but the difference is amazing. Right now I am using the 75hp jets and soon I will be jumping up to the 100hp jets. The car pulls really hard with just the 75 shot, I cant wait to see what times I can get with the 100 shot.

C&L Intake - $290.00
Nitrous - $550.00
Racers kit - $305.00
Dyno Tune - $150.00??

Total - $1,300.00

I would definetly reccomend getting a LSD, it will run you about $300.00. That will get you two wheels spinning instead of one. And get the SCT-Xcal 2, that will run you about another $400.00, so you are looking at right about $2,000 all said and done. Good Luck.

Your estimate is a little off. Lets fix it just a bit

Nitrous - $550.00
Racers kit - $305.00
SCT Xcal with intake - $550.00
Tlok - 200'ish plus install costs...another 200-300'ish, might as well get gears at the same time so 200'ish more - $600.00 or so.
Dyno Tune - about $80 an hour for dyno time and then whatever your tuner charges. - $150.00 ish

Total - $2155

This is if you want the nitrous to actually be effective to its full potential.
I believe some members have said $40-$50(considering that once you fill it the initial time you're not going to run it completely empty) to refill the bottle. I think nitrous runs 4.00 something per lb. and the bottle is 15lbs.
